Part Overview

The SIM-N2-2FF3FF4FF is a global IoT SIM card manufactured by Hologram, Inc., supporting multiple form factors (2FF Mini, 3FF Micro, 4FF Nano) with compatibility across 2G, 3G, and 4G LTE IoT networks. The product is currently listed as obsolete, making identification of functionally equivalent alternatives essential for ongoing system support and component procurement.

Engineering Selection Recommendations

GL1-100 Substitution Criteria:

The GL1-100 is an active product from the same manufacturer with identical regulatory classification (ECCN 5A992C, HTSUS 8524.69.0000). It provides a viable alternative for applications requiring 2G network connectivity and 3FF (Micro) form factor compatibility. The GL1-100 offers superior inventory availability (11569 units) compared to the obsolete SIM-N2-2FF3FF4FF (1021 units).

Scope Limitations:

Applications requiring 3G or 4G LTE IoT connectivity should evaluate whether the GL1-100's 2G-only network support meets system requirements. Systems dependent on 2FF (Mini) or 4FF (Nano) form factors cannot use the GL1-100, which supports only 3FF (Micro) format. The GL1-100 operates within -25°C to 85°C, suitable for standard industrial IoT deployments.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q: Can GL1-100 replace SIM-N2-2FF3FF4FF in all applications?

A: No. The GL1-100 supports only 3FF (Micro) format and 2G networks. Replacement is valid only for systems using 3FF form factor and not requiring 3G or 4G LTE connectivity.

Q: What is the physical dimension difference between these parts?

A: The SIM-N2-2FF3FF4FF measures 5mm L x 6mm W x 0.82mm H, while the GL1-100 measures 5mm L x 6mm W x 0.75mm H. The 0.07mm thickness difference is within standard SIM card tolerance ranges.

Q: Are both parts subject to the same export regulations?

A: Yes. Both parts share identical ECCN (5A992C) and HTSUS (8524.69.0000) classifications, ensuring equivalent regulatory treatment.
